BE Power Equipment is a leading manufacturer of pressure washers, air compressors, generators and water pumps serving industrial markets in over 30 countries. Headquartered in Abbotsford, BC, our third generation, family-owned business is focused on designing quality products and delivering exceptional service.

OUR IDEAL CANDIDATE WILL HAVE THE FOLLOWING EXPERIENCE:
- 5+ years’ experience providing technical support, troubleshooting equipment and being a “go-to” product expert for customers and end users.
- Industry related experience in power equipment, agriculture, automotive, power tools, or manufacturing preferred.
- Knowledge and experience working with small engines or power equipment.
- Proficient with the Microsoft Office Suite of products (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int)

Responsibilities:
- You are BE Power’s product expert & biggest fan! You’ll provide end-user support for our customers when they need some help, advice, or a better understanding of how to use our products.
- You will play an active role in troubleshooting our products & equipment to resolve any customer challenges or technical issues with a “customer first” & “solution focused” mindset.
- Enthusiastically & professionally answer requests from customers regarding general product information, maintenance or repairs and/or processing of warranty claims.
- Conduct end-user training as BE’s product expert, allowing customers to feel at ease and in good hands.
- Collaborate with our service center network providing the best technical assistance & training possible.
- Get creative and put those technical skills to use through the development of service bulletins & training packages.
- Be strategic through playing an active role in various projects and key initiatives which ultimately impact the growth and success of the organization.
- Enjoy travelling throughout Canada (approximately 20%), while maintaining a healthy work-life balance.
